My stock 45 for this has a listed time of (3:17), and an actual time of (3:25). My deadwax is "N-E1-N543M10". It is Gordy G-7084, same as the stock # listed in my book for the listed (4:30), actual (4:46) stock 45 version. My 45 also lists the song title as "Runaway Child, Running Wild", not "Run Away Child,....".

My 45 states a run time of (4:30) yet actually runs (4:41) and has matrix number N-E1-N-537M02, The song title on mine is Run Away...(2 words).
